Economic conditions and road transport costs – October 2023

During the third quarter of 2023, fuel prices returned to particularly high levels and other operating costs continued to rise at a rate higher than general inflation:

  • In road freight transport (RFT), commercial diesel rose by +17.6% over the last quarter and other costs rose by +5.6% on an annual basis.
  • In road passenger transport (TRV), commercial diesel rose by +16.4% over the last quarter and other costs rose by +7.9% on an annual basis.

Economic growth remains severely hampered by inflation. Inflation is falling compared to 2022, but is still expected to exceed the +5% threshold in most G20 countries in 2023. The very recent increases in bank rates are exacerbating the difficulties in global demand, and trade in goods is also sluggish. Several major countries are at risk of entering periods of recession.

France is expected to see GDP growth of +0.9% in 2023.
